By Gillows, Lancaster - An early 19th Century rosewood rectangular occasional table:, the top with rounded corners, on turned column trefoil platform and bun feet, the top 59cm (1ft 11in) x 43cm (1ft 5in).*Notes Stamped to the underside of the trefoil platform Gillows, Lancaster.
An early 19th century mahogany oval drop flap extending dining table:, the hinged top with a moulded edge, on turned and reeded tapered legs, terminating in brass castors, the top 113cm (3ft 8 1/2in) x 112cm (3ft 8in) and with three additional leaves extending to 231cm (7ft 7in).
A Victorian rosewood circular scallop edge dining table:, the snap top with a moulded edge on turned central column and foliate carved and moulded quadruped splayed legs, terminating in foliate scroll feet and castors, 158cm (5ft 2in) diameter.* Note To be sold on behalf of Rowcroft Hospice
A matched silver Kings pattern flatware service, various makers and dates: initialled, includes three table spoons, five desert spoons, five teaspoons, one coffee spoon, three soup spoons, two sauce ladles, six table forks, six desert forks and one butter knife, total weight of silver 2393gms, 76.94ozs.
A George III silver Kings pattern part flatware service, maker William Chawner II, London, 1819: initialled includes twelve table forks and eleven dessert forks, together with matched silver plated flatwares including twelve table knives, sixteen dessert forks, twelve dessert forks, six soup spoons, twelve table knives and twelve dessert knives. total weight of silver 1810gms, 58.19ozs.
A French burr walnut, inlaid and gilt metal mounted dressing table:, of kidney-shaped outline, crossbanded in tulipwood, bordered with boxwood and ebony lines, the oval bevelled swing frame mirrored superstructure mounted with twin bracket lights and on standing nude female figure and open scroll supports, fitted with a frieze drawer below on turned tapered legs, headed with shells and foliage, terminating in brass cappings and castors, 98cm (3ft 2/12in) wide.
A matched Hanoverian rat tail pattern flatware service, various makers and dates predominantly Francis Higgins III, London, 1894 and 1898: crested, includes, four tablespoons, thirteen dessert spoons, eleven teaspoons, three sauce ladles, eleven table forks, fifteen dessert forks, twelve steel bladed silver pistol grip table knives and twelve similar dessert knives, and six matched butter knives, together with a small amount of matched plated flatwares including eight table spoons, eight dessert spoons, one teaspoon, four table forks and four dessert forks, weighable silver 3042gms, 97.81ozs
A set of four Victorian silver table salts, maker Thomas White, London, 1881: of plain circular form, on beaded circular feet, with four matching salt spoons, cased; together with a pair of silver pepperettes of baluster form, cased, total weight of silver 336gms, 10.82ozs.
A George III and later inlaid mahogany sofa table, the ebony inlaid top with reeded edge over two frieze drawers with simulated drawers to the other side, the end supports joined by a spirally reeded stretcher on sabre legs terminating in brass paw feet on castors, 128cm wide (open), 62 cm deep and 73cm high
